Obituary

Taniya Anderson, 6 weeks, of Coatesville, passed away suddenly on Sunday, June 1, 2014, at the Brandywine Hospital. Born in West Chester on April 14, 2014, she was the beloved daughter of Terry L. Anderson, Jr. and Christina Hamilton.

Baby Taniya , was a sweet girl who had an infectious smile and personality that warmed the heart of every person she met. Sh e brought immense joy and happiness to his family and touched the lives of many people affected by her presence. Taniya was a delight to have here with us for just a short time.

In addition to her parents, she is survived by her paternal grandparents, Dorinda Westmoreland and her husband Stephen Westmoreland of Coatesville and Terry Lee Anderson, Sr. of Coatesville; maternal grandparents, Charmaine Alston Thompson of Coatesville, Melvin Hamilton and his wife Colleen Hamilton. She is also survived by four siblings; Malana Hicks, Chrishawn Hamilton, Tahjay Lamont Anderson, Ti'Aisjah Louise Anderson and a large extended family of aunts, uncles and cousins.

Memorial services will be held at 10 am on Saturday, June 7th at Wright Funeral & Cremation Services, 725 Merchant Street, Coatesville. A visitation will be held from 9 am to 10 am.

Interment will be held in New Evergreen Cemetery, Coatesville.
